I had one like that.  I carefully tapped a soft bullet into the muzzle and once it was fully into the barrel I used an old cleaning rod to knock it down until it pushed the brass out through the breech end.  I don't remember who gave me the idea, but it worked very well.

In my case it was a breech seated black powder paper patch load that ripped the case in half.

I had that happen with a gun once. I simply dunked the whole works in a pot of boiling water. Strained the cold water to save the cerrosafe, and concurrent deep cleaning of the gun was an unintended beneficial consequence to boot.

I keep a small aluminum funnel with a long-ish flex hose to administer cerrosafe. Trick is to pre-heat it when pre-heating the barrel.
